How Being Eco-Friendly Can Impact Studio Retention, Relationships, and Client Loyalty

Across multiple industries, being environmentally conscious and aware is a top priority for consumers. When it comes to their fitness and wellness routine, brands (including your fitness studio) leaning into eco-friendly practices are being noticed by leads and members. Research shows that 78% of consumers feel that sustainability is essential, 55% are willing to pay more for eco-friendly brands—and 84% say that poor environmental practices will alienate them from a brand or company. All those disposable cups by the water station at your studio going into the trash versus the recycling bin? Even the little things might have a negative impact on how your clients perceive sustainability at your studio.

While there are certain things you might do at your studio that are hard to pivot to be more environmentally friendly (like the wipes your clients use to clean mats after hot yoga), there are a few accessible practices and products you can implement that not only help protect the planet but also positively reflect your mission and values for overall, well-rounded well-being. It’s more than sustainable swaps, though. Being eco-friendly positively impacts retention and studio brand loyalty because your clients care (and pay attention). Plus, your environmental efforts are something you can promote across your marketing efforts long after Earth Month! 

Here’s how to easily empower your studio to become more eco-friendly—and what it means for your fitness business, client relationships, and your bottom line!

Channeling Mother Earth: 10 tips to make your studio more sustainable

1. Energy-efficient lighting solutions

Consider upgrading your studio's lighting fixtures to LED or energy-efficient options. LED lights consume significantly less energy and have a longer lifespan than traditional incandescent bulbs. Additionally, installing motion sensors or timers can help optimize energy usage by automatically turning off lights in unoccupied areas.

2. Natural and non-toxic cleaning products

Switching to natural and non-toxic cleaning products reduces staff and client exposure to harmful chemicals while minimizing environmental impact. Look for eco-friendly cleaning solutions that are biodegradable, plant-based, and free from harsh chemicals like chlorine, ammonia, and phthalates. Also, consider opting for refillable bottles and recurring natural cleaning memberships, like the Grove Collaborative

3. Reusable water stations

Install water refill stations or filtered water dispensers in your studio to encourage clients to refill their reusable water bottles instead of single-use plastic bottles. Consider offering branded stainless steel or glass water bottles as merchandise options (or as a gift for new clients who convert from intro offer to membership), further promoting sustainability among your clientele while elevating your brand.

4. Sustainable flooring materials

When renovating or designing your studio space, opt for eco-friendly and sustainable flooring materials. Recycled rubber flooring made from discarded tires, cork flooring sourced from renewable oak trees, or bamboo flooring known for its rapid regrowth are excellent choices that offer durability and longevity—and look beautiful and high-quality to your clients. A visual and eco-friendly studio differentiator. 

5. Recycled and upcycled equipment

Choose fitness equipment made from recycled materials whenever possible. Many manufacturers offer yoga mats, foam rollers, and resistance bands made from recycled rubber or plastic. Additionally, explore opportunities to upcycle old equipment or repurpose materials, from Megaformers to free weights, to extend their lifespan and reduce waste. 

6. Digital operations and communication

7. Biodegradable disposables 

If disposable items are necessary, opt for biodegradable alternatives made from renewable resources. Choose compostable paper towels, disposable cups made from plant-based materials like PLA (polylactic acid), and biodegradable trash bags derived from cornstarch or sugarcane. Also, select fully biodegradable feminine products if you’re stocking your studio bathroom facilities.

8. Eco-friendly merchandise

Stock your studio's retail area with eco-friendly merchandise that aligns with your sustainability values. Offer sustainable workout apparel from organic cotton, recycled polyester, or bamboo fabric. Showcase eco-conscious yoga mats and accessories crafted from natural materials like jute, cork, or organic cotton.

9. Indoor plants for air quality (and a natural aesthetic)

Introduce indoor plants into your studio space to improve air quality and create a healthier environment for clients and staff. Plants add aesthetic appeal and help purify the air by removing pollutants and releasing oxygen. Consider low-maintenance varieties such as snake plants, pothos, and spider plants. 10. Community recycling and waste reduction initiatives 

Implement a comprehensive recycling program within your studio to properly manage waste and promote recycling among clients and staff. Educate individuals about proper waste sorting and disposal techniques and provide designated bins for recyclables, compostables, and landfill waste. Consider partnering with local recycling facilities or organizations to further support waste reduction efforts in your community.

Now that we’ve covered simple ways to embrace eco-friendly efforts, here’s how implementing them at your fitness studio can significantly impact brand loyalty and client retention. 

Powerful impact: 6 ways your environmental efforts can influence client/studio relationship 

1. Values alignment

Your members are increasingly seeking businesses and brands aligning with their values, including environmental sustainability. By demonstrating a commitment to eco-friendly practices, your studio shows that it shares clients' concerns about the environment. This alignment of values creates a sense of connection and loyalty among clients who appreciate your studio's dedication to sustainability.

2. Positive brand image

Adopting eco-friendly initiatives enhances your studio's brand image as a responsible and socially conscious business. Clients are more likely to view your studio favorably and feel proud to be associated with a brand that prioritizes environmental sustainability. A positive brand image contributes to client loyalty and encourages them to continue supporting your business.

3. Differentiation in a crowded space

In a competitive boutique fitness industry, standing out from the competition is crucial for attracting and retaining clients. Incorporating eco-friendly practices sets your studio apart from others in the market and provides a unique selling proposition. Clients prioritizing sustainability are likelier to choose your studio over competitors who do not prioritize environmental initiatives.

4. Enhanced client experience

Eco-friendly initiatives can enhance the overall client experience at your fitness studio. From using non-toxic cleaning products that create a healthier workout environment to providing sustainable merchandise options in your retail area, these initiatives contribute to a more positive and holistic client experience, boosting loyalty and authentic word-of-mouth marketing.

5. Community engagement

Environmental sustainability often resonates with local communities and fosters a sense of camaraderie among residents. By implementing eco-friendly practices, your studio actively participates in community efforts to protect the environment. This engagement strengthens client connections and deepens the sense of community, leading to higher client retention rates.

6. Long-term cost savings

Many eco-friendly practices, such as energy-efficient lighting, water conservation measures, and waste reduction initiatives, can result in long-term cost savings for your studio. Reducing utility expenses and minimizing waste generation can improve operational efficiency and profitability. Passing on these savings to clients through competitive pricing or enhanced services further reinforces their loyalty to your studio.

Overall, being eco-friendly at your fitness studio benefits the environment, fosters brand loyalty, and enhances client retention. By aligning with clients' values, creating a positive brand image, differentiating from competitors, improving the client experience, engaging with the community, and achieving long-term cost savings, your studio can build lasting relationships with clients who appreciate your commitment to sustainability.
